Techniques in Prayer Therapy by Dr. Joseph Murphy Pdf

Dr. Joseph Murphy, the author of The Power of Your Subconscious Mind, wrote this book as a manual to teach people how to pray. He teaches how to maintain prayer as a part of one's everyday activity, as well as how to use prayer in the case of danger or an emergency. According to Murphy, prayer is an ever-present help in time of trouble, but you do not have to wait for trouble to make prayer an integral and constructive part of your life. People can find the source of their goodness and get the results they desire through proper prayer. Your desire is your prayer. Picture the fulfillment of your desire now and feel its reality and you will experience the joy of the answered. -Dr. Joseph Murphy

Dr. Joseph Murphy has been acclaimed as a major figure in the human potential movement, the spiritual heir to writers like James Allen, Dale Carnegie, Napoleon Hill, and Norman Vincent Peale, and a precursor and inspirer of contemporary motivational writers and speakers like Tony Robbins, Zig Ziglar, and Earl Nightingale. He changed the lives of people all over the world and was one of the best-selling authors of the mid-20th century. Dr. Murphy wrote, taught, counseled, and lectured to thousands every Sunday as Minister-Director of the Church of Divine Science in Los Angeles. Over the years, Dr. Murphy has given lectures and radio talks to audiences all over the world. Millions of people tuned in his daily radio program and have read the over 30 books that he has written. His books have sold over 15 million copies. The Psychology of Prayer by Bernard Spilka,Kevin L. Ladd Pdf

Reviewing the growing body of scientific research on prayer, this book describes what is known about the behavioral, cognitive, emotional, developmental, and health aspects of this important religious activity. The highly regarded authors provide a balanced perspective on what prayer means to the individual, how and when it is practiced, and the impact it has in people's lives. Clinically relevant topics include connections among prayer, coping, and adjustment, as well as controversial questions of whether prayer (for oneself or another) can be beneficial to health. The strengths and limitations of available empirical studies are critically evaluated, and promising future research directions are identified.
